Nonthaburi (Thailand), Jan. 19 -- The Indian women's futsal team staged a sensational comeback to defeat Pakistan 5-3 in the SAFF Women's Futsal Championship 2026 at the Nonthaburi Stadium here on Monday.

Pakistan had taken the lead twice in the game and were 3-1 up at one stage before India, coached by Joshuah Vaz, struck four goals in the final 12 minutes to seal the win and go top of the table after matchday 4.

The Futsal Tigresses are on nine points from four games, followed by Bangladesh, who have seven points from three. Pakistan also have seven points but trail on goal difference.
